This is an exciting opportunity to join our client's established 'Someone to Talk to' service in a Team Lead role. The Team Lead will manage and oversee a team of staff and volunteers supporting young people across our client's two hubs in their North Locality, in Peterborough, Huntingdon and Wisbech. The Team Lead will work closely with the other Team Leads and Heads of Service to jointly ensure their multidisciplinary teams deliver excellent, safe, impactful and responsive services to young people.
They are looking for a highly motivated professional with experience working within a mental health or youth work role, and with experience of managing people. The Team Lead will bring strong expertise and leadership to their mental health support offer for young people aged 13 - 25 years, leading the teams delivering counselling and the wider, flexible emotional wellbeing offer.
They will be responsible for providing support with case allocation, case management, reflective practice, risk management and Safeguarding. They will provide day-to-day designated Safeguarding leadership, supported by the Head of Service and Director of Services. They will develop strong relationships with local organisations and statutory services to ensure effective joint working and support for young people. This role may deliver ad hoc case work to support young people with more complex needs but will hold only a limited ongoing, regular case load.
The hours of work for this role are predominantly within core opening hours of 10am to 6pm, with some evening / Saturday working based on a rota. Due to our client's service delivery, it is important that the Team Lead is available for hub-based work during their core working hours.
